
The Municipal Environmental School 15 de Outubro is located in the Northern Zone of Teresina (PI) within the João Mendes Olímpio de Melo City Park. The facility is closely connected to its territory and functions as an educational space integrated with the public landscape. Developed through a partnership between the Federal University of Piauí and the municipal government, the project is planned to serve 1,000 students in a full-time program. The design incorporates environmental education principles, climate comfort strategies, and landscape integration from the beginning. The school is conceived as more than a building, offering a spatial experience where architecture, nature, and collective use continuously interact to enhance urban space and strengthen the relationship between public infrastructure and the environment.
